Speaker constitutes committee to end dispute over ‘Namaz’ room in Jharkhand Assembly

Lagatar News by Lagatar News
September 9, 2021
in Jharkhand
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

 

 

RAJ KUMAR

 

Ranchi, Sept.9: Taking a major step to end the deadlock over the allotment of a room for offering Namaz, the state assembly constituted a seven-member committee to take a decision on the allotment of a room for offering Namaz in the assembly premises.

The committee members are Stephen Marandi (JMM), Pradeep Yadav (Independent), Neelkant Singh Munda (BJP), Sarfaraz Ahmed (JMM), Vinod Singh (CPI-ML), Lambodar Mahto (Ajsu) and Deepika Pandey Singh (Congress).

Speaker Rabindranath Mahto announced the committee informing the legislators that the committee has been given a deadline of 45 days to submit its report.

“Though the committee has been given 45 days to submit its report, I expect it to submit its report before the deadline,” speaker Mahto said.

Earlier, the House passed four bills. The bills include Jharkhand State Open University Bill 2021, Jharkhand Panchayati Raj (Amendment) Bill 2021, Jharkhand State Fiscal Responsibility and Budget Management (Amendment) Bill 2021, and Finance Bill- 2021.

Before the Jharkhand State Open University Bill 2021 was passed, CPI-ML legislator Vinod Singh suggested sending it to the select committee for its enrichment in the larger interest of the people but the same was not allowed.
